Understanding the Technologies
DTG printing is akin to a specialized inkjet printer for fabric. It directly applies a water-based ink onto the garment. This method is excellent for achieving soft-feel prints, especially on 100% cotton items.
DTF printing, on the other hand, involves printing your design onto a special film. This film then has a powdered adhesive applied to it. Finally, the design is heat-pressed from the film onto the garment. This process opens up possibilities for a wider range of fabrics and colors.
Key Differences in Application and Results
The primary distinction lies in how the ink or design is transferred to the fabric. DTG is a direct application, while DTF uses an intermediary film. This difference impacts several crucial factors for custom apparel.
Fabric Compatibility: Where Do They Shine?
-
DTG printing works best on natural fibers, with 100% cotton being the ideal substrate. While it can be used on cotton blends, the print quality and vibrancy may be reduced. Pre-treatment of the garment is essential for proper ink adhesion.
-
DTF printing boasts superior fabric versatility. It can be applied to cotton, polyester, blends, nylon, leather, and even dark-colored garments without the need for pre-treatment. This makes it a more flexible option for diverse apparel projects.
Design Considerations: Detail and Durability
-
DTG printing excels at producing highly detailed and photographic prints. The ink soaks into the fabric fibers, resulting in a soft hand feel that integrates seamlessly with the garment. However, it can be less durable on synthetic fabrics and may fade over time with frequent washing.
-
DTF printing offers vibrant colors and excellent opacity, even on dark garments. The printed design sits on top of the fabric, creating a slightly more tactile feel than DTG. This method is known for its durability and resistance to cracking, making it a robust choice for logos and graphics that need to withstand regular wear and washing.
Color Output and White Ink
-
DTG printing handles white ink exceptionally well, providing a solid base for printing on dark garments. The white ink acts as an underbase, ensuring that the colors printed on top appear bright and true.
-
DTF printing also produces vibrant colors on both light and dark fabrics. The white ink is printed onto the film first, then the CMYK colors are printed on top, ensuring excellent color vibrancy and opacity.
Cost and Turnaround Time
The cost and speed of DTF vs. DTG can vary. Generally, DTG can be more cost-effective for smaller runs or single-item printing due to less setup. However, for larger orders, DTF can become more competitive. Turnaround times are often comparable, but can depend on the printer’s workflow and equipment.
Comparison Table: DTF vs. DTG at a Glance
| Feature | DTG (Direct to Garment) | DTF (Direct to Film) |
|---|---|---|
| Ideal Fabric | 100% Cotton, high-cotton blends | Cotton, Polyester, Blends, Nylon, Leather, Dark Fabrics |
| Print Feel | Soft, integrated into fabric | Slightly more tactile, sits on top of fabric |
| Design Detail | Excellent for intricate, photographic designs | Very good, vibrant colors and sharp lines |
| Durability | Good on cotton, can be less durable on blends | Excellent, resistant to cracking and fading |
| White Ink Usage | Excellent opacity and vibrancy on darks | Excellent opacity and vibrancy on darks |
| Pre-treatment | Required for optimal results | Not required; adhesive powder is used |
| Setup Complexity | Simpler for small runs, direct print | Requires film printing and heat press application |
| Best For | T-shirts, light-colored cotton apparel, detailed art | Hoodies, hats, bags, dark apparel, logos, high-wear items |
When to Choose DTF Printing
DTF printing is an excellent choice when you need maximum fabric flexibility. If you’re printing on polyester hoodies, nylon hats, or even leather accessories, DTF is likely your best bet. Its durability also makes it ideal for team uniforms, corporate apparel, and promotional items that will see a lot of use. The ability to achieve vibrant colors on dark garments without extensive pre-treatment is another significant advantage.
When to Choose DTG Printing
DTG printing is the go-to for projects that prioritize a super-soft feel and are primarily using 100% cotton garments. It’s perfect for artistic t-shirts, band merchandise, or any application where the print should feel like a natural part of the fabric. If you’re printing detailed, full-color photographic images on light-colored cotton tees, DTG will deliver stunning results.

### What is the main advantage of DTF printing?
The primary advantage of DTF printing is its versatility across different fabric types and colors. Unlike DTG, which is best suited for cotton, DTF can print vibrantly on polyester, blends, nylon, and even dark fabrics without requiring extensive pre-treatment, making it a highly adaptable solution for custom apparel.
### Is DTG printing good for dark t-shirts?
Yes, DTG printing is good for dark t-shirts, but it requires a white ink underbase. The printer applies a layer of white ink first, then prints the color design on top. This ensures the colors appear bright and opaque, rather than being dulled by the dark fabric. However, DTF often offers superior vibrancy on darks.
### How long do DTF prints last?
DTF prints are known for their excellent durability. When applied correctly with proper heat and pressure, they can last for many washes without significant fading, cracking, or peeling. The adhesive powder creates a strong bond with the fabric, contributing to the longevity of the design.
